Ann is on page 37 of 199 of Nearing a Far God: Praying the Psalms with Our Whole Selves
Leslie’s formula for meditating and praying in the psalms is simple, yet so profound!
Understand the historical and theological context
Preserve the theology of the psalm
Write and speak into and out of the psalm to illustrate, witness, and respond to the truths of God‘s word, not to alter them.

The path of relearning prayer is a journey into deeper love; into deeper attachment to God! Ch 1
